- Fixed asset financing institution by another permanent funds own funds plus long-term loans and medium-term sense.

- Current assets financed by short-term loans.

- We can keep the financing of part of the current assets of permanent funds safety margin and this margin knows Permanent working capital.

The 3 basic are classed as short term, medium term long term. The short term financing options are usually to finance a businesses consumables normally spread over a 12 months period e.g overdraft. The medium term financing are more for bridging the fund gap for asset over 1-5yrs e.g invoice factoring. finally long term financing are for capital spend which require long period e.g bonds/gilts & Mortgage
